Finally made it here. Wish I?d come sooner. Good bar food selection with beer and wine (no hard liquor). Small or large (32oz)... beers. Old school atmosphere with pull tabs, pool, and darts. Covered seating in the back. This is a good place. Read more

Sloop is a local bar in the Ballard area. It's decently sized inside with a few seats outside as well. Pricing here is pretty... good and service is good. There are definitely a lot of regulars that come here and it makes it feel very local, but it's a nicespot off the main part of Market to get away from the normal stuff. Their food here is actually really good, and the portionsizes are good as well. Read more
